INTERNATIONAL TIGER DAY • International Tiger Day was
celebrated on 29th July 2019.
• Children were educated about
Tiger's day every morning during
assembly and reinforcement was
done during class hours in their
respective classes.
• The knowledge given to children
about Tigers were as follows :
1. Tigers belong to the cat family.
2. Tiger is a wild animal which eats
meat.
3. Tiger is the National Animal of
India.
4. Tigers growl and roar.
5. Tigers have three colors on their
body which are orange, black &
white.

Super minute competition
• Competition is always good. It forces us to do
our best as we set a standard for ourselves
and strive to achieve it.
• Super minute competition was based on
sorting beads according to their respective
colours.
• The one who accumulated the most number
of beads was declared winner at the end of
the competition.
